An example of a benign hyperkeratotic skin lesion is:

Biology
1 answer:
Hoochie [10]3 years ago
3 0
An example of a benign hyperkeratotic skin lesion is corn or callus. The corns and calluses are hard thickened parts of skin that form as a result of rubbing friction or compression on the skin. The corns and calluses form on the feet and can make hiking painful. A soft corn has a much thinner exterior that look like whitish and rubbery and typically take place amid the toes.

A computer simulation showing models of planes crashing is a good way to study the effects of plane safety.why?
MAXImum [283]

Answer:

Flight simulators are widely used for pilot training in the aviation industry, military pilot training, simulation of disasters or failures in flight, and aircraft development.

These simulations are used for pilot training, whose essential function is to train the crew in normal, abnormal and emergency procedures, before and during flight, practicing innumerable situations, such as: failures in electronic systems, loss of power, tailwinds and many others, which cannot be done safely with an aircraft in real situations. Explains to the new pilots the movements and attitudes of the ships, becoming a fundamental part of the training, saving lives and large economic losses.

These simulations allow knowing the causes of each plane crash in order to modify the operating procedures and training, so that its repetition is avoided. Flight safety investigations are complex and analyze numerous factors, and rather than investigating the persons responsible, it tries to find out the causes of the incident, considering human factors and technical issues.
